README improved
This commit is contained in:
parent
a3d95101b3
commit
ff80bd9725
1 changed files with 24 additions and 0 deletions
24
README.md
24
README.md
|
@ -12,3 +12,27 @@ Verkaufsdaten nach dem Verkaufsende auszutauschen.
|
||||||
|
|
||||||
Ebenso können über einen ESC/POS-Drucker Quittungen ausgestellt werden.
|
Ebenso können über einen ESC/POS-Drucker Quittungen ausgestellt werden.
|
||||||
|
|
||||||
|
## Installation
|
||||||
|
Auf [rustysoft.de](https://www.rustysoft.de) werden verschiedene Installationspakete (Arch Linux,
|
||||||
|
Ubuntu, Windows) angeboten. Bitte die Hinweise dort beachten.
|
||||||
|
|
||||||
|
### Selbst compilieren
|
||||||
|
KIMA2 benötigt folgende Libraries:
|
||||||
|
* Qt5
|
||||||
|
* jsoncpp
|
||||||
|
* xlnt >= 1.3.0
|
||||||
|
* boost >= 1.62
|
||||||
|
* libusb-1.0
|
||||||
|
|
||||||
|
Da Features aus C++17 verwendet werden sowie std::filesystem, sollte als Compiler mindestens
|
||||||
|
GCC 8 verwendet werden.
|
||||||
|
|
||||||
|
Die Installationsschritte unter Linux sind wie folgt:
|
||||||
|
```
|
||||||
|
cd kima2-cpp
|
||||||
|
mkdir build && cd build
|
||||||
|
cmake -DCMAKE_BUILD_TYPE=Release ..
|
||||||
|
make
|
||||||
|
sudo make install
|
||||||
|
```
|
||||||
|
|
||||||
|
|
Loading…
Reference in a new issue